Your work

What you’ll do

  • Hire, develop, and retain a team of TDLs embedded in Financial Services engagements. Set a high bar for delivery judgment, technical fluency, and customer presence, and run the interviews that hold it.
  • Manage each TDL directly: regular 1:1s, clear expectations, direct feedback, and a growth plan. Build a bench that runs engagements well without you in the room.
  • Own portfolio health across the vertical. Track which engagements are on track, at risk, or closing out, and intervene early when delivery drifts. Run engagement quality reviews with your team.
  • Own customer outcomes across the portfolio. Hold the executive relationship with customer sponsors, run steering committees, and represent Anthropic's credibility with senior business, risk, and engineering leaders.
  • Make the staffing call for each engagement. Work with FDE managers to match TDLs and engineers to each customer, and adjust as scope changes.
  • Lead the most complex engagements yourself. Take the TDL seat when engagement size, regulatory exposure, or organizational complexity calls for it, from delivery plan through production.
  • Set the bar for delivery excellence — SOW quality, MVP scoping, and value measurement. Ensure every engagement has a defensible impact story.
  • Codify reusable solution patterns, evaluation frameworks, and technical playbooks across the team. Turn what works in the field into delivery infrastructure that lets the practice scale.
  • Partner with Sales to qualify engagements, shape scope, and inform SOWs. Partner with Marketing and Sales on Financial Services–specific go-to-market materials, reference cases, and positioning.
  • Run the team's operating rhythm: engagement reviews, knowledge-sharing, and escalation support, and report into the wider post-sales cadence and dashboards. Set team goals tied to customer outcomes.
  • Bring the field back to Anthropic. Surface delivery lessons and emerging Financial Services use cases to Product and Research, and represent the vertical in leadership discussions.
  • Consistently uphold Anthropic's values as you lead your team. TDLs should be strong representatives of Anthropic's culture as they work within customer environments.
  • Travel to customer sites (25–50% expected).

  • You have delivered technology programs inside banks, insurers, or asset managers, you understand how model risk, security, and compliance review shape what ships, and you can speak credibly with a CIO, a chief risk officer, and a head of engineering.
  • Annual Salary: $240,000—$450,000 USD Logistics Minimum education: Bachelor’s degree or an equivalent combination of education, training, and/or experience Required field of study: A field relevant to the role as demonstrated through coursework, training, or professional experience Minimum years of experience: Years of experience required will correlate with the internal job level requirements for the position Location-based hybrid policy: Currently, we expect all staff to be in one of our offices at least 25% of the time.
  • However, some roles may require more time in our offices.
  • We offer competitive compensation and benefits, optional equity donation matching, generous vacation and parental leave, flexible working hours, and a lovely office space in which to collaborate with colleagues.

Eligibility

Visa sponsorship: We do sponsor visas! However, we aren't able to successfully sponsor visas for every role and every candidate. But if we make you an offer, we will make every reasonable effort to get you a visa, and we retain an immigration lawyer to help with this.
